Transaction 3fcac3e8f388447f1050c850a1818a360bff8f11c4432a242d529197685dc2b1

block
cba20ab93204e04ee70efcf35d619ee133f3494b8a172bf26fde304657dc9e1e

5 Inputs

2 Outputs